Correlation Between Rbc Ultra-short and Touchstone Premium
Can any of the company-specific risk be diversified away by investing in both Rbc Ultra-short and Touchstone Premium at the same time? Although using a correlation coefficient on its own may not help to predict future stock returns, this module helps to understand the diversifiable risk of combining Rbc Ultra-short and Touchstone Premium into the same portfolio, which is an essential part of the fundamental portfolio management process.
By analyzing existing cross correlation between Rbc Ultra Short Fixed and Touchstone Premium Yield, you can compare the effects of market volatilities on Rbc Ultra-short and Touchstone Premium and check how they will diversify away market risk if combined in the same portfolio for a given time horizon. Pair Trading with Rbc Ultra-short and Touchstone Premium
The main advantage of trading using opposite Rbc Ultra-short and Touchstone Premium posit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Rbc Ultra-short position performs unexpectedly, Touchstone Premium can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
